Charge warning display
Type 1
Type 2
If there is a fault with the charging system, the warn-
ing display is displayed on the information screen
in the multi-information display. The warning lamp
in the instrument cluster also illuminates.
CAUTION
l
If the warning is displayed while the en-
gine is running, immediately park your ve-
hicle in a safe place and we recommend
you to have it checked.
Oil pressure warning display
E00524800242
Type 1
Type 2
If the engine oil pressure drops while the engine is
running, the warning display is displayed on the in-
formation screen in the multi-information display.
CAUTION
l
If the vehicle is driven while the engine
oil is low, or the oil level is normal but the
warning is displayed, the engine may
burn out and be damaged.
l
If the warning is displayed while the en-
gine is running, immediately park your ve-
hicle in a safe place and check the engine
oil level.
l
If the warning is displayed while the en-
gine oil level is normal, have it inspected.
Engine oil level warning display*
E00524900256
Type 1
Type 2
On vehicles equipped with 4HK engine, when the
ignition switch is "ON", if the engine oil level is be-
low the specified limit, the warning display is dis-
played on the information screen in the multi-infor-
mation display.
On vehicles equipped with 4N14 engine, when the
ignition switch is in ON, if it is suspected that the
engine oil level has increased excessively, the warn-
ing display is displayed on the information screen
in the multi-information display.
CAUTION
l
If this warning is displayed while driving,
stop the vehicle in a safe place, turn off
the engine, and check the engine oil level.
Refer to "Engine oil" on page 8-04.
